Fun Party Food Ideas
You may be a gourmet, but a party calls for some fun food with a laid back style. Fun party food ideas, are basically simple items cooked with ease and enjoyed as the party heats up. Since, it's a party reeling under the mood of fun and frolic, your guests aren't going to be really bothered about how it is presented or how is it cooked. Keep it as simple as possible and in sufficient quantities, so that your guests can relish it till the end. If you really want to make a fun menu at the party, I suggest go with the theme. Party goers love to experiment and wouldn't leave a chance to try out something new.
Party Food for Kids
Kids, chocolate and sweets, is one of the combination, that can never go wrong. I mean, I still drool over those delicious Nigella Lawson recipes made for kids. If it's a birthday party, then a cake becomes your inevitable option for the party. A fruit punch, with some zesty flavor and vibrant color, will be a great hit among the kids. Sandwiches, with Nutella spread, potato chips, warps with vegetables or meat (the choice is yours), tortilla with a suitable fillings, cookies, burgers, cup cakes and ice creams are treats that kids will never get bored of!
Party Foods for Adults
There is a lot that one can experiment with, when it comes to party appetizers and meals for adults. There are no barriers to your culinary experiments, when it comes to deciding a menu for an adult party. However office party food ideas are clearly different from fun food party ideas. Cheesy onion dips, fried raviolis, chicken lollipops, croissants, tomato and basil sandwiches, hummus and pita bread, salads, fish fingers, salsa and chips, pizza muffins, unforgettable pizzas, burgers, rolls and wraps, tortillas, desserts and pastas will never go out of appeal.
Party Beverages
A party without a beverage is incomplete. Coming up with non-alcoholic beverages is sometimes difficult. Apricot sparkler, apple apricot smoothie, banana tropical, bubbling pineapple punch, raspberry punch, a chilled cappuccino, chocolate shake and iced teas are some of the non-alcoholic beverages that you can serve at your party. There are a lot of alcoholic drinks that you can serve at the party.
Parties come with a lot of leftovers. Hence, it's important to know the right amount of quantity that will be required. Well, you may not get there 'exactly', but minimum wastage of food is what you must aim for. To know the quantity that will be required, know the headcount. Send out invitations, beforehand with RSVP, so that you know the number of guests likely to attend the party. If it's a kids birthday party, parents are always likely to stay, so do count them in, while ordering for the food.
Place the order well in advance, so that you can make changes if required. Since, you have a lot of guests coming in, it's advisable to serve them in disposable. This way, you save the time required in washing and cleaning them. If it's a party of adults, then you may hire the crockery and cutlery too. Have fun!
